This past weekend’s 2011 NBA All-Star Weekend was definitely one of the more memorable All-Star Weekend’s in recent memory that included an amazing Rookie/Sophomore Game, phenomenal All-Star Saturday Night, and of course one of the greatest All-Star Game’s of our generation as we witnessed LeBron James and Kobe Bryant go at it for four quarters. While we’ve already shown you what the players wore during the festivities we do have some images to share of various NBA All-Stars and Legends showing up to the game via the T-Mobile Magenta Carpet last night. While almost all of the current and ex-players were dressed up in suits, Kobe Bryant, Amar’e Stoudemire, and Dwight Howard stood out from the crowd deciding to go with a bit of a casual approach, choosing to wear sneakers instead of dress shoes. Kobe and Amar’e being Nike athletes wore Nike Sportswear sneakers including an all White Air Force 1 and Khaki Toki respectively while Dwight Howard showed up wearing a pair of Gucci sneakers.
